免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

网页打包成app在线

在如今的数字时代,移动应用正在迅速成为用户获取信息和使用服务的首选途径。许多网页开发者希望将他们的网站转化为移动应用,以便让用户在移动设备上更方便地访问内容和功能。网页打包成App在线是一种将网页内容封装为原生移动应用的方法。本文将详细讲解这个过程的原理和实现步骤,并给出一些实用的在线工具,以帮助初学者快速上手。

**原理**

在详细介绍网页打包成App的过程之前,让我们先简要了解一下它的原理。网页应用和原生应用有很大的不同。原生应用是专门为特定操作系统(如iOS和Android)构建的,而网页应用则是基于HTML、CSS和JavaScript等通用编程语言编写的,可以通过任意支持网络的浏览器访问。

网页打包成App实际上是在原生应用的外壳中嵌入一个名为Web View的组件。Web View组件能够呈现网页内容,并为其提供与原生应用相似的用户体验。这使得网页应用能够在移动设备上像原生应用一样运行,从而让开发者可以重复使用他们的网页代码。这种方法显著降低了开发和维护成本,也引入了更广泛的用户群体。

**实现步骤**

1. 准备网站

首先,确保您的网站是响应式的,适应各种屏幕尺寸。这样,用户在移动设备上访问时可以获得良好的体验。同时,请优化网站的加载速度,以提高在移动设备上的性能表现。

2. 选择在线打包工具

有很多在线工具可以帮助您将网页打包成App。一些常用和受欢迎的工具包括:PhoneGap Build、Cordova、Appgyver和WebViewGold。这些工具提供了教程和模板,让您能够轻松地将网页内容转换为移动应用。

3. 设置工程和编写配置文件

在选择了合适的在线打包工具后,您需要创建一个新的项目,并为其编写一个称为“配置文件”的文件,以便告诉工具如何构建您的应用。配置文件主要包含应用的名称、描述、图标等信息,以及一些特定于平台的设置。

4. 编写原生代码(可选)

如果您希望为网页应用添加一些原生功能(如通知、地理位置等),您可能需要编写一些原生代码。大多数在线打包工具都支持使用插件来实现这一点,这意味着您不需要从头开始编写复杂的代码。

5. 测试

在将网页打包成App之后,务必在不同类型的移动设备上进行测试,以确保应用的兼容性和性能。此外,还要检查API和功能的正常运行,以及优化用户体验。

6. 发布

当您对应用的测试结果满意后,可以将其发布到各大应用商店,如Apple App Store和Google Play。在此之前,请遵循应用商店的指南,准备好所有必要的资料和素材。

**总结**

网页打包成App在线是一种快速、经济的方法,可以将您的网页变成移动设备上的原生应用。通过利用在线工具和插件,开发者可以在不牺牲用户体验的情况下重复利用他们的网页代码。虽然这种方法有其局限性,但对于许多场景,尤其是内容驱动的网站来说,它提供了一个非常实用的解决方案。


相关知识:
云打包app
云打包App:原理与详细介绍随着智能手机的普及和移动互联网的发展,各行各业对于移动应用的需求日益增长。很多企业和个人开发者都在关注如何快速、高效地开发和发布App。近年来,一种名为“云打包”的技术应运而生,它为广大开发者提供了一个便捷的解决方案。本文将详细
2023-05-12
将小程序打包成ios应用
Title: 将小程序打包成iOS应用:原理与详细介绍随着智能手机的普及,手机应用成为了各种业务的重要载体。许多开发者希望能在各大应用市场推出自己的应用,以便在众多竞争对手中脱颖而出。对于那些开发过小程序的开发者来说,将小程序打包成iOS应用是一个很好的方
2023-05-12
打包app上架
打包App上架原理及详细介绍随着移动互联网的普及和发展,App已成为我们日常生活中不可或缺的一部分。为了让自己的App更方便地被用户下载和使用,开发者需要将其上架到各大应用商店。本篇文章将详细介绍打包App及上架的原理和过程。一、App打包原理及流程1.
2023-05-12
安卓app重打包
安卓应用重打包(Android App Re-Packaging)是一种技术手段,广泛应用于安卓应用开发和破解领域。它实际上是对原始安卓应用的源代码进行修改、优化甚至破解后,再次打包成一个新的安卓应用程序。通过重打包技术,我们可以实现安卓应用的定制开发与破
2023-05-12
wap2app打包
WAP2APP打包:原理与详细介绍随着互联网的快速发展,越来越多的企业和个人选择将其业务扩展到移动应用市场。然而,开发原生应用并非易事,特别是对于那些没有专业移动应用开发背景的人来说。这也就带来了一种名为WAP2APP的技术,它允许用户将现有的网站或Web
2023-05-12
pyqt5打包apk
标题:PyQt5 打包成 Android APK 详细教程与原理简介内容提要:在本文中,我们将详细讨论如何将使用 PyQt5 开发的应用程序打包为 Android 应用(即 APK)。同时,也会简要介绍相关原理。本教程适合各个层次的人员,尤其是刚刚入门的开
2023-05-12
mui打包原生app
标题:如何使用MUI打包原生APP:原理与详细介绍概述随着智能手机的普及,移动应用已经成为了我们日常生活中不可或缺的一部分。与此同时,移动应用开发需求的迅速增长也使得各种不同的技术应运而生。在这个背景下,MUI(Mobile User Interface
2023-05-12
html一键打包apk工具
标题:HTML一键打包成APK工具—原理与详细介绍随着移动互联网的不断发展,越来越多的开发者开始将网站或Web应用转换成移动应用程序,即使他们原本并非手机应用开发者。这样做的目的是为了提供更加便捷的用户体验,以及响应日益增长的移动设备市场。然而,许多刚入门
2023-05-12
h5做的页面可以打包成app吗
HTML5页面打包成APP是指将利用HTML5、CSS3和JavaScript等web技术开发的应用,通过一定的方法和技术,将其转换成可以在手机设备上运行的APP。在过去,我们都知道HTML5主要是用于制作网页应用的,而APP,则是需要编程语言如Java、
2023-05-12
apk打包知乎
标题:APK打包详解:从原理到实践的完整指南APK(Android Package Kit)是一种专为Android系统开发的应用安装包,在我们的日常生活中,我们会在各大应用市场如Google Play商店、豌豆荚、知乎等进行下载并安装各种应用。但究竟AP
2023-05-12
androidapk打包
标题:Android APK打包:原理与详细介绍随着智能手机的普及和作品平台的多样化,Android平台愈发受到开发者和用户的关注。作为Android应用的安装包,APK文件在整个开发过程中起着举足轻重的作用。本文将为大家详细介绍Android APK打包
2023-05-12
android打包apk签名
Android打包APK签名详解在Android应用开发过程中,对于已完成的应用,我们需要对其进行打包并签名,以便于发布到各大应用市场。那么,Android打包APK签名到底是什么?为什么我们需要对APK进行签名?接下来,我们将详细介绍Android打包A
2023-05-12